The problem slinky solves
The problem slinky solves is that it makes claiming/redeeming and using tokens easier for people while allowing them to remain fully anonymous using the Daml contracts that we wrote and are able to be used on the site currently. The combination of making payments easier with just a link that leaks nothing, does not save to a database of any sort and keeps trust in the sender, it positions us to be in a great position for making payments easier, and more private.
Challenges we ran into
We ran into challenges during the implementation of canton's daml contracts and we made sure to adhere to the guidelines. We used the hackathon guidelines and had to go and talk to the devs at the canton booth about the issues, we got it fixed and were able to work on it later, although we were not able to fully deploy it to devnet, we got really close and I managed to make it still work on a live demo link with the sandbox canton ledger on the website, running just as similarly to how a devnet would on the Canton Network.
